The Car Repair Ratings website provides consumer reviews and ratings for garages in the United States and Canada. The time customers wait for service to be completed is one of the categories rated. The following table provides a summary of the wait-time ratings (1 = Slow/Delays; 10 = Quick/On Time) for 40 randomly selected garages located in the province of Ontario, Canada (Car Repair Ratings website, November 14, 2012).
Wait-Time Rating |
Number of Garages |
1 | 6 |
2 | 2 |
3 | 3 |
4 | 2 |
5 | 5 |
6 | 2 |
7 | 4 |
8 | 5 |
9 | 5 |
10 | 6 |
- a. Develop a
probability distribution for x = wait-time rating. - b. Any garage that receives a wait-time rating of at least 9 is considered to provide outstanding service. If a consumer randomly selects one of the 40 garages for their next car service, what is the probability the garage selected will provide outstanding wait-time service?
- c. What is the
expected value and variance for x?
Suppose that 7 of the 40 garages reviewed were new car dealerships. Of the 7 new car dealerships, two were rated as providing outstanding wait-time service. Compare the likelihood of a new car dealership achieving an outstanding wait-time service rating as compared to other types of service providers.
